Information about the withdrawal of the Dmitry Donskoy submarine missile carrier from the fleet has been refuted

Information about the decommissioning of the Russian navy submarine missile carrier project 941UM "Shark" "Dmitry Donskoy" does not correspond to reality. This was reported by several sources in the shipbuilding industry and law enforcement agencies of the North.

The information that appeared about the write-off of the last "Shark" was denied. It is reported that no one has written off the missile carrier, currently it is in the open sea, where it performs combat training tasks. A decision on its future fate will be made no earlier than December of this year, when the technical condition of the nuclear submarine and the nuclear fuel reserve will be checked. At the same time, it is possible that the service life of the Dmitry Donskoy will be extended for another 4-5 years.

The next reports about the withdrawal of the Dmitry Donskoy from the Russian Navy do not correspond to reality. The ship is currently performing combat training tasks at sea, participating in combat training events. He will remain in combat formation at least until the end of the year

- TASS quotes the words of one of the sources.

Earlier, unofficial information appeared in a number of media outlets that "Dmitry Donskoy" was taken out of combat and will soon be disposed of. They started talking about the decommissioning of the submarine for a long time, last year it was reported that after the laying of two new APRCS of the Borey-A project, one of which will be named Dmitry Donskoy, the last Shark will remain just a numbered TK-208 submarine and will be used for weapons tests.

The heavy nuclear-powered strategic missile submarine TK-208 Dmitry Donskoy is the lead in a series of six submarines of the 941 Akula project. Laid down at Sevmash on June 17, 1976, launched on September 23, 1980, commissioned on December 29, 1981. In 2002, he underwent modernization, after which he took part in the tests of the Bulava rocket.
